Smile US Postal uses Fedex Planes

I saw a Fedex truck down at the big South Postal facility in Boston one day and I commented to the guy at the counter that isn't funny that Fedex drops off their packages to the US Post Office to ship. He said it is actually the other way around, US Postal Service sends their pakages to Fedex to use their planes.

I always try to shop around, I have found sometimes it is cheaper at he post office and sometimes not, depends on what you are shipping. I was trying to ship a rod one time and like TD the USPS wanted $65, I went to UPS main office in South Boston and they wanted $65. You have to get someone behind the counter that is not stupid or not trying to screw you. Finally I went to Willship (has multiple carriers) in Weymouth on 53, the owner Gary was very knowlegable and I shipped my rod for $20 via UPS (I packaged it myself in 5" PVC tube). Didn't pay for next day service but I dropped it off at 2:00 PM and it was delivered next day by 8:00 AM to New Jersey and I could follow the package online the whole way.

FYI - Rod builders will snip an inch or two off a 9 foot rod because it is sometimes cheaper to ship, once you go over 9 feet some places jack up the delivery price.
